What are some typical challenges faced by a Live In Butler, and how can they be managed effectively?

A Live In Butler often navigates challenges such as maintaining discretion, managing a wide variety of household tasks, and adapting to the unique preferences of different employers. Balancing the need for professional boundaries while building trust with the household is key. Effective communication, organization, and flexibility are essential to anticipate needs and resolve issues promptly. Many butlers find that setting clear expectations and routines with employers helps ensure smooth operations and a positive working relationship.

What are live-in butlers?

Live-in butlers are professional household staff members who reside on the employer’s property and are responsible for a wide range of domestic duties. Their tasks often include managing other staff, overseeing household operations, serving meals, greeting guests, and maintaining the home's presentation and security. Because they live on-site, live-in butlers are typically available for both scheduled and occasional needs, offering a high level of service and flexibility. This arrangement allows them to quickly respond to their employer’s requirements and ensures the smooth running of the household.

What is the difference between Live In Butler vs Housekeeper?

AspectLive In ButlerHousekeeper
CredentialsHospitality or service-related certifications, experience in high-end settingsCleaning and organizational skills, sometimes certifications in cleaning or hospitality
Work EnvironmentLuxury residences, private estates, high-net-worth householdsResidential homes, hotels, private estates
Employer & IndustryWealthy families, estate managers, luxury service providersHomeowners, property managers, hospitality industry

While both roles involve maintaining a household, a Live In Butler provides comprehensive personal service, including managing staff and assisting with daily needs, whereas a Housekeeper primarily focuses on cleaning, organizing, and maintaining the cleanliness of the home. The Live In Butler's role is more service-oriented and often requires broader hospitality skills, while the Housekeeper's role centers on household upkeep.
